Ingredients
-
2 -3 lbs boneless skinless chicken thighs
-
3 tablespoons butter
-
1 medium sweet onion, finely chopped
-
1 tablespoon garlic powder or 1 tablespoon fresh minced garlic
-
3/4 cup ketchup
-
1/2 cup water
-
1 tablespoon apple cider vinegar
-
1 teaspoon lemon juice
-
4 tablespoons brown sugar
-
1 tablespoon buffalo wing sauce
-
1 1/2 tablespoons Worcestershire sauce
-
2 tablespoons prepared mustard
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 375 degrees F.
- In a large nonstick skillet, melt butter over medium heat being careful not to burn.
- Add the chicken and lightly brown.
- Remove chicken and place in a 9x13-inch baking dish.
- Add onion (if using fresh garlic in place of garlic powder, also add) to the skillet and saute lightly for about 2-3 minutes.
- Meanwhile, in a medium bowl, combine the remaining ingredients and mix well.
- Pour the mixture into the skillet and stir to combine.
- Simmer the sauce for about 15 minutes to allow the flavors to blend nicely.
- Pour sauce over the chicken, then flip pieces so that both sides of the chicken are coated with the sauce.
- Bake the chicken uncovered for about 30-40 minutes or until the chicken is no longer pink and the juices run clear.
